Monthly Cost of Living

A single person spends $1,675 per month in Colmar vs $1,721 in Canterbury, rent included.

A couple spends around $2,790 per month in Colmar vs $2,700 in Canterbury, rent included.

A family of three spends $3,905 per month in Colmar vs $3,679 in Canterbury, rent included.

Colmar is about 3% cheaper than Canterbury, driven mainly by Eating Out.

Both Colmar and Canterbury sit above the global median – Colmar by 25%, Canterbury by 29%.

Cost Breakdown

A central one-bedroom costs $740 in Colmar versus $949 in Canterbury. Rent is usually the largest line item in a monthly budget, so the gap here sets the tone for the overall comparison.

Salaries run about 36% higher in Canterbury, which partly offsets the higher cost of living there. Purchasing power depends on which expenses matter most to you.

A mid-range dinner for two costs $73.0 in Colmar versus $67.0 in Canterbury. Groceries tell a different story – $265 in Colmar vs $287 in Canterbury – so Colmar wins on supermarket bills even if dining out costs more.
